#5db783 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5db783 is composed of 36.5% red, 71.8%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 28.4% yellow and 28.2% black. It has a hue angle of 145.3 degrees, a saturation of 38.5% and a lightness of 54.1%. #5db783 color hex could be obtained by blending #baffff with #006f07.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

Shades and Tints of #5db783

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#f2f9f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#5db783

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8a8a8a is the less saturated color, while #1ef679 is the most saturated one.
